ALAMOSA — Authorities are still investigating the apparent October 2012 homicide of a Valley man, and they’re asking anyone who might have any information about the incident to come forward.
In particular, they want to hear from eyewitnesses who may have observed any activity at or near 401 11th St. between the hours of midnight and 7 a.m. on Oct. 28.
Firefighters arrived at that address just after 6 a.m. that day, following a report of a structure fire. As they worked their way through the fully engulfed structure, they found the body of a 55-year-old man who was later identified as Glen Olivas.
At that point, the Alamosa Police Department and the Colorado Bureau of Investigation were called to this scene of the incident, which remains under investigation as a homicide and an arson.
Those who have any information, please call Alamosa Police Capt. Robert Jackson at 589-2548, or Colorado Bureau of Investigation Agent Mark Morlock at (719) 542-1133.
